Hidden Home Pests



Are you knowledgeable about the surprise home parasites that may be lurking in your home? While you may be vigilant about typical insects like ants or crawlers, there are other stealthy burglars that could be creating harm behind the scenes.



One such pest is the silverfish, a little pest that flourishes in wet and dark atmospheres like basements and shower rooms. These pests can damage books, clothing, and also wallpaper, making them a problem to manage.

Another surprise pest to watch out for is the carpeting beetle. These little pests feed upon a selection of materials located in homes, such as carpetings, garments, and furniture. Their larvae can create significant damage if left unchecked, making it essential to deal with any kind of indications of invasion quickly.

In addition, mold and mildew mites are frequently neglected but can indicate a moisture concern in your house. These little animals prey on mold and mildew and can aggravate allergies for delicate individuals. Maintaining your home completely dry and well-ventilated can assist stop these parasites from settling in your living spaces.

Unwelcome Intruders



Undesirable trespassers can disrupt your house peace and cause damage if not taken care of immediately. While pests like rodents and roaches are typically recognized, various other lesser-known burglars like silverfish and carpet beetles can also wreak havoc in your home. Silverfish are tiny, wingless insects that grow in damp locations and eat starchy materials like paper and glue, triggering damage to books, wallpaper, and clothing. Carpet beetles, on the other hand, delight in a range of items such as carpets, garments, and upholstery, leading to expensive damage if left uncontrolled.

These unwanted burglars not just harm your belongings yet can additionally present health threats. Rodents and roaches, for instance, can spread conditions via their droppings and pee, polluting surfaces and food. Silverfish and carpeting beetles can activate allergic reactions in some people, bring about skin inflammation and breathing problems.

To stop these trespassers from taking over your home, it's critical to preserve tidiness, seal off entry factors, and without delay resolve any type of signs of problem.
